Hospital Overview and Mission
Alta View Hospital operates as a cornerstone facility within the Intermountain Health network, one of the nation’s leading integrated healthcare systems. Located in Sandy, Utah, this acute-care hospital serves the greater Salt Lake Valley with a commitment to providing accessible, high-quality healthcare to diverse communities. The facility’s mission centers on delivering patient-centered care that respects individual values while leveraging the latest medical advancements.
The hospital’s foundation rests upon decades of experience in emergency medicine, surgical services, and inpatient care. With a dedicated workforce of physicians, nurses, and support staff, Alta View Hospital maintains a reputation for responsiveness to patient needs and attention to clinical detail. Emergency and Trauma Care: The emergency department operates as the hospital’s frontline, staffed with board-certified emergency medicine physicians and experienced trauma nurses. The facility maintains Level III trauma center designation, meaning it can stabilize and manage trauma patients before transfer to higher-level centers when necessary. Diagnostic Imaging: CT and MRI scanners provide detailed anatomical visualization essential for diagnosis and treatment planning. Digital radiography reduces radiation exposure while improving image quality. Ultrasound capabilities support both diagnostic evaluation and image-guided interventional procedures. These imaging modalities are staffed by board-certified radiologists who interpret findings and communicate results to treating physicians promptly.
Laboratory Services: Advanced analyzers process blood work and other laboratory tests rapidly, enabling quick clinical decision-making. Point-of-care testing devices in the emergency department and operating rooms provide immediate results when minutes matter. Quality control measures ensure accuracy and reliability of all laboratory data.
Electronic Health Records: Comprehensive electronic medical records integrate information from all hospital departments and outpatient facilities within the Intermountain Health network. This integration ensures that physicians have complete patient information when making clinical decisions. Security measures protect patient privacy while allowing appropriate information sharing among authorized providers.
Monitoring Systems: Continuous cardiac monitoring in intensive care units and step-down units enables rapid detection of arrhythmias or deterioration. Pulse oximetry and capnography provide real-time assessment of respiratory and oxygen status. Automated alarms alert nursing staff to clinically significant changes requiring immediate intervention.
Medication Administration Systems: Barcode verification systems prevent medication errors by confirming patient identity before medication administration. Automated dispensing cabinets track medication inventory and usage. These systems enhance patient safety by reducing the risk of wrong-patient, wrong-medication, or wrong-dose errors.

What insurance plans does Alta View Hospital accept?
Alta View Hospital, as part of Intermountain Health, accepts most major insurance plans including Medicare, Medicaid, and commercial insurance. Patients should verify their specific coverage before scheduled procedures. Financial counselors can discuss payment options and financial assistance programs for uninsured or underinsured patients.
How can I access my medical records from Alta View Hospital?
Patients can request medical records through the hospital’s health information management department. Records are typically available within 10-15 business days. Electronic copies may be available through the patient portal, allowing immediate access to recent test results and clinical notes.

What should patients bring when admitted to Alta View Hospital?
Patients should bring insurance cards, identification, current medications, and a list of allergies. Comfortable clothing for recovery and personal hygiene items are helpful. Valuables should be left at home or secured safely, as hospitals cannot guarantee security of personal items.
